ROSZDRAVNADZOR ELIMINATED SIGNS OF COMPETITION RESTRICTION IN THE MARKET OF PHARMACEUTICAL REFRIGERATOR EQUIPMENT

21-03-2019 | 12:48

The Federal Service for Healthcare Supervision executed FAS warning to stop actions (omissions) that contained signs of violating the antimonopoly law

 

As informed earlier, re-registering pharmaceutical refrigerators, Roszdravnadzor changed their codes of the National Products Classifier by types of economic operations (OKPD2). As a result, the price of the equipment, selling which previously had not been subject to value added tax (VAT), increased by 18 % (from 1 January 2019 - by 20 %).

 

The antimonopoly body issued a warning to Roszdravnadzor to adjust the codes of medical products in line with the law of the Russian Federation by 15 March 2019.

 

Deputy Head of FAS Department for Control over Social Sphere and Trade, Maxim Degtyaryov, emphasized: “Rozdravnadzor notified FAS that the manufacturer of pharmaceutical refrigerators had been issued new registration certificates with correct OKPD2 codes. Thus, signs of competition restriction on the market of pharmaceutical refrigerator equipment have been eliminated timely and FAS is not going to open a case against Rozdravnadzor for violating Part 1 Article 15 of the Federal Law “On Protection of Competition”.

 

 

1 Under Article 39.1 of the Federal Law “On Protection of Competition”, if a warning is executed, an antimonopoly case is not opened and the person that executed the warning is not held liable for violating the antimonopoly law due to its elimination.
